Master of Ultra-Thin

Georges Edouard Piaget established his watchmaking workshop in La Cote-aux-Fees, Switzerland, in 1874. The brand became renowned for its mastery of ultra-thin movements, setting numerous world records for the thinnest watches ever made. This technical expertise, combined with artistic gem-setting and jewelry design, established Piaget as a unique presence in high watchmaking.

Society Jeweler

In the 1960s and 70s, Piaget became the jeweler-watchmaker of choice for international high society, creating bold, colorful pieces using hard stones like lapis lazuli, turquoise, and jade in both watches and jewelry. The Piaget Society aesthetic, blending watchmaking and jewelry, remains central to the brand’s identity.

Richemont Portfolio

As part of the Richemont group, Piaget continues to push the boundaries of ultra-thin watchmaking while maintaining its expertise in high jewelry. The Altiplano collection and the Piaget Polo remain cornerstone collections that express the brand’s distinctive blend of technical innovation and elegant design.
